How to prepare for a job interview at Kenna Recruitment Ltd

Know Your Numbers

As a Quantity Surveyor, you'll need to demonstrate your expertise in managing budgets. Brush up on your financial acumen and be ready to discuss how you've successfully managed costs in previous projects. Prepare specific examples that highlight your ability to stay within budget while ensuring quality.

Understand the Legal Landscape

Compliance is key in this role, so make sure you’re familiar with relevant legal requirements in residential refurbishment. Research any recent changes in regulations that might affect the industry. Being able to discuss these confidently will show that you're proactive and knowledgeable.

Project Management Prowess

This position involves overseeing various projects, so be prepared to talk about your project management skills. Have examples ready that showcase your ability to coordinate teams, manage timelines, and resolve conflicts. Highlight any tools or methodologies you use to keep projects on track.
